An RPA developer’s job is to identify, develop, and activate software robots, also called bots, that automate processes to increase efficiency. This role requires strong communication skills as it includes you speaking to users to identify processes that would be more efficient when automated. Recruiters would expect you to have a bachelor’s degree in computer science or a related field and would like to see a master’s degree in a similar field. Business process specialists are one of the most versatile professionals in this industry. These workers manage their tasks in various departments simultaneously. In most cases, you can find business process specialists in marketing, accounting, sales, and supplier departments. The role consists of verifying that financial resources have an efficient administration during every process. In addition, these employees can identify errors in production and promote appropriate and budget-friendly solutions. Critical thinking, business management, and math are top-rated skills for this job. Companies also hire business process specialists to reduce unnecessary expenses and apply program management software to automate more activities.
Operations process specialists are supervisors who can participate in almost all corporate departments. These workers develop monitoring plans for each enterprise' area. Their main task is to analyze the workflow, resolve irregularities, improve collective production, and meet goals through advanced techniques. This occupation oversees all operations related to production and customer services. For this reason, operation process specialists combine leadership and human resource management skills to obtain the best results from each employee. Other responsibilities in this job include writing company policies, work manuals, and corporate instructions.
Senior process specialists are leaders of all production-related departments within a company. These specialists also work as consultants and offer support to employees regarding work policies, instructions, and processes. Professionals in this field also authorize changes in work methodology and supervise daily activities. Senior positions have a lot of experience on large projects. Usually, this occupation requires promotions and trajectory within the same company.
The robotic process automation analyst is responsible for identifying automation opportunities in an organization. They work alongside stakeholders to identify their goals and deliver solutions through automated devices. The robotic process automation analyst also oversees the implementation and adaptation process of new technology. This is why they need exceptional communication skills. The customer service supervisor is a leadership position who oversees many facets of a customer service team. These individuals usually have extensive experience in customer-facing and/or team leadership roles. As a customer service supervisor, you will be responsible for training and mentoring customer service representatives, tracking employee performance, monitoring key metrics, solving high-level issues and complaints, and more. To become a customer service supervisor, you should have keen problem solving skills, strong leadership abilities, and be an effective multitasker. For this role, a minimum of an associate's degree is necessary, however a bachelor’s degree could help you land this role more easily. Moreover, hiring managers will be looking for candidates with 3-5 years experience in customer-facing roles, such as experience as a sales representative, customer care representative, or telephone sales representative. You must show hiring managers you understand how to effectively manage and solve customer complaints. In addition, candidates for the role should have excellent time management and leadership skills.
